Artist

Rosemary Clooney

visual
Aliases
Rosemary Clooney with Chorus and Orchestra
Born
May 23, 1928
Died
June 29, 2002
Country
United States
Comments
Singer and actress. Aunt of the famous actor George Clooney.
Family
Betty Clooney Sister
Debby Boone Daughter-in-law
José Ferrer Spouse (1954-1961; 1964-1967)
Gail Stone Half-sister
